Bookkeeper Position at the Cambridge Buddhist Centre

By Pasadanita on Mon, 8 Sep, 2025 - 12:49

Bookkeeper Position at the Cambridge Buddhist Centre

By Pasadanita on Mon, 8 Sep, 2025 - 12:49

We’re looking for an Order Member or Mitra to join our friendly and dedicated team, starting late autumn 2025. This role offers a unique opportunity to engage with the inner workings of a busy Buddhist Centre, be part of a supportive team, and to integrate spiritual practice into daily working life.

Role Details

The bookkeeper role involves a commitment of 25 hours per week. Duties include recording transactions, managing accounts payable and receivable, reconciling bank accounts, preparing payroll, keeping financial records, preparing financial reports,...

Suvana Cohousing

By Centre Team on Fri, 19 Apr, 2024 - 17:06

Here’s a great conversation between Jnanavaca and Tejasvini about the creation of a visionary new project in Cambridge, UK. Part of Suvana Cohousing’s vision is to create a multi-generational community, and also to provide some housing for Triratna retirees. For example, people who have lived many years in Buddhist communities but may need to have their own living space in retirement. And also younger people who struggle to find secure housing.

Dharmabyte: The Essence of Padmasambhava

By Sadayasihi on Mon, 19 Oct, 2020 - 07:00

Prasannavira offers insight into the the essence of Padmasambhava – purity, love, skillful means. With a fearless embracing of experience, taking whatever appears as the Path, facing of inconvenience both personal and external deeper truths, we become the change we’d like to see in the world.

From the talk entitled Who Is Padmasambhava? Given for Padmasambhava Day at Cambridge Buddhist Centre, 2017.
